Summit Road is a 0.3 km 4WD trail in Nelson City, Nelson, New Zealand. Expect includes a river crossing.

You'll navigate river crossings that form the highlight of this route, requiring careful line selection and steady throttle control to maintain traction through flowing water. The terrain demands your full attention despite the relatively flat 0% grade—river crossings present their own unique hazards including variable water depth, slippery rocks, and potential current forces that can catch inexperienced drivers off-guard. Before attempting Summit Road, ensure your vehicle is properly maintained with adequate ground clearance, functioning differentials, and waterproofed electrics. Check current water levels and flow rates, as seasonal conditions can significantly impact crossing difficulty.
